iPass has an employee rating of 3.0 out of 5 stars, based on 127 company reviews on Glassdoor which indicates that most employees have an average working experience there. The iPass employee rating is 22% below average for employers within the Information Technology industry (3.9 stars).

Pros

Good colleagues. Product does help travelers with their connectivity. Great office location. Lots of responsibility for each team member, and opportunity to make big impact for company. Company is public, fortunes appear to be turning the corner. Word is getting around about the value of the services. Nasdaq: iPAS

Cons

Management views staff as completely disposable. The team experiments and makes large changes on regular basis, and has switched directions a couple times in my short stint here. They are very stingy with bonus and commission compensation. Whether this is their all star performers or people they want to show the door, everybody gets low balled. Turnover is amazing in so many departments. Sales, marketing, HR, operations, finance. It doesn't matter. They have had layoffs for several years, and even with new management 2016 was no exception. They laid off so many people they had to bring back a couple to do critical jobs a couple months later. Nepotism is practiced here despite this being a public company. Good jobs also given to ex-employees and family friends of leadership (ex. CEO, CCO). If you're not in the gang, and things get tough, you are and will be disposable since there are protected staff members here. The public stock and financials look ok, but the restructuring seems to have no end.
